WebMetroll offer a range of purlins and girts from 100mm to 400mm in Z and C profiles, cut to length, un-punched or punched. All purlins and girts are manufactured from high tensile, G450, G500 or G550 galvanised steel, with a minimum Z350 coating. DURASHINE® Purlin is a structural component, roll-formed from high strength galvanised steel with 120 g/m2 Zinc coating mass, which saves more than 30% of the steel by weight.
